The Hoa bylaws template for regulations in Texas serves as a foundational document for homeowner associations (HOAs), outlining the structure, responsibilities, and governance procedures pertinent to Texas law. Key features of the template include provisions for the annual and special meetings of shareholders, the election and qualifications of directors, and detailed protocols for voting, including proxy voting and quorum requirements. It details the roles of officers, including the President and Secretary-Treasurer, and sets forth procedures for managing contracts, loans, and financial transactions. Filling and editing instructions emphasize the necessity of specifying corporate details like the official name and registered office, while allowing flexibility in structuring meetings and determining quorum requirements based on the unique needs of an HOA. Notably, Texas HOA's with 60 or more lots are legally required to have an HOA Website, ensuring transparency and accessibility for all members. The HOA Website Law in Texas is designed to facilitate better communication and provide a centralized location for important association information.

House Bill 614 guarantees your right to a hearing before the HOA board to contest the violation or the proposed fine. This ensures a fair and transparent process where you can voice your concerns and advocate for your interests.

The new law went into effect on Jan. 1, 2024. HOAs are mandated by law to provide property owners with a catalog outlining prohibited items, a fine timetable, and details on the conduct of hearings. The information must be posted to their website and given annually to residents via delivery, first-class mail, or email.

Disclosure Requirements Disclosure is mandated by law, often through public records and real property records. Before purchasing a home, buyers must receive a set of documents detailing the HOA's health, such as its covenants, conditions, restrictions, bylaws, rules, and financial statements.
